首先,我是javascript和asp.net的新手。所以请耐心等待。我想要做的是嵌入vesselfinder.com的地图并添加一个搜索框。现在我遇到了一些问题,我正在尝试读取名为txtMMIS.Text的文本框的值,但是当我运行网站时,我无法将txtMMIS.Text的值传递给javascript中的变量mmsi。我不知道现在该做什么。我知道这对其他人来说非常简单。任何帮助将非常感谢。谢谢大家。
代码:
<script type="text/javascript">
var width = "900";
var height = "470";
var latitude = "19";
var longitude = "120";
var zoom = "4";
var fleet_hide_old_positions = false;
var names = true;
var click_to_activate = false;
var default_maptype = 2;
var mmsi = '\"' + document.getElementById('<%=txtMMIS.ClientID %>').value + '\"';
var show_track = true;
</script>
<script type="text/javascript" src="https://www.vesselfinder.com/aismap.js">
</script>
文本框代码:
<asp:TextBox ID="txtMMIS" runat="server" value="354925000"></asp:TextBox>